Abstract

The invention relates to a device for releasing active agents, characterized in that at a frequency of 0.1 rad/s, it has a glass transition temperature of less than 15° C., contains at least 3% by weight of an SEPS block copolymer and contains at least one substance with a local or systematic effect which does not cause hyperaemia. The device is not foamed.
